Trump Hails Iran Ceasefire as ‘Total and Complete Victory’

In a press conference held at the White House, US President Donald Trump stated that the provisional ceasefire agreed upon with Iran constitutes a ‘total and complete victory’ for American diplomacy. The ceasefire, confirmed earlier this week, brings an end to recent heightened tensions between the two nations following the US deployment of additional troops to the Mideast region.

According to President Trump, key concerns regarding Iran’s nuclear program were directly addressed in the agreement. He claimed that the accord ‘perfectly takes care of’ Tehran’s uranium issue, citing it as a primary point of contention in the negotiations. No concrete details were provided by administration officials, however, surrounding the specifics of Iran’s compliance or what mechanisms will be implemented to ensure its adherence to future agreements.

US Secretary of State Mike Pompeo also spoke at length on the subject, noting that Iranian compliance is being constantly monitored through a network of intelligence and surveillance. Pompeo further stated that Iran’s cooperation with international organizations in charge of nuclear regulation would be ‘closely watched’ in the coming months.

When asked about potential concerns from Iranian opposition groups or regional partners regarding the agreement, Trump dismissed these concerns outright. He pointed to Iran’s growing domestic discontent, stating that Tehran’s leadership should focus on addressing the ‘many internal issues’ plaguing the nation rather than ‘frittering its energy on confrontation with the US.’

Trump’s optimistic tone on the agreement has generated debate among analysts and international observers. Some have questioned the potential for long-term success of the accord given past instances of Iranian noncompliance with international nuclear regulations.
